The Benefits Of Anti Harassment Training Online

In today’s digital age, combating harassment in the workplace has become more important than ever. With the rise of remote work and virtual interactions, it is crucial for companies to provide anti harassment training online to ensure a safe and inclusive work environment for all employees. Online training programs offer a convenient and effective way to educate employees on how to recognize and prevent harassment in the workplace.

There are many benefits to implementing anti harassment training online. One of the most significant advantages is the accessibility of online training programs. With online training, employees can access the course materials from anywhere with an internet connection. This flexibility allows employees to complete the training at their own pace, making it easier to fit into their busy schedules. This can be especially beneficial for remote employees or those who work non-traditional hours.

Another advantage of online anti harassment training is the ability to tailor the content to the specific needs of the organization. Companies can customize the training materials to reflect their own policies and procedures, ensuring that employees are receiving relevant and up-to-date information. This personalized approach can help to reinforce the company’s commitment to creating a safe and inclusive work environment.

Online training programs also offer a cost-effective solution for companies looking to provide comprehensive harassment prevention training. Traditional in-person training sessions can be expensive, requiring companies to cover costs such as venue hire, travel expenses, and catering. With online training, companies can save money on these expenses while still providing high-quality training to their employees. In addition, online training programs can reach a larger audience, making it a more scalable option for companies of all sizes.

One of the key benefits of anti harassment training online is its effectiveness in educating employees on the importance of recognizing and preventing harassment in the workplace. Online training programs can include interactive elements such as quizzes, case studies, and role-playing scenarios to engage employees and reinforce key concepts. This hands-on approach can help employees to better understand the impact of harassment and empower them to speak up and take action if they witness or experience inappropriate behavior.

Furthermore, online training programs can track employee progress and completion rates, allowing companies to monitor the effectiveness of their training initiatives. By collecting data on which employees have completed the training, companies can identify gaps in knowledge and target additional training to those who may need it. This data-driven approach can help companies to continuously improve their anti harassment training programs and ensure that employees are equipped with the necessary skills to prevent harassment in the workplace.
